
In the tiniest shred of positive news today, Sharon Osbourne mentioned on their podcast that Ozzfest will be returning, and she’s planning to host two days at VP.
For those who may not know, Ozzfest was the precursor to what is now Download Festival at Donnington Park- a rock and metal festival ran by Ozzy and The Osbourne family.
This is great news from a legacy point of view, but also massive for revenue. We’ve seen with Tottenham how lucrative the event side to their business can be, so it’s great that we seem to becoming the go-to place for big rock gigs in the West Midlands. In recent years we’ve had Foo Fighters, Guns N’ Roses, last year’s Ozzy show, and now this.
